摘要
The sorption behavior of Cs-137 onto kaolinite, bentonite, illite, and zeolite was studied at different ionic strengths of Na+, K+, Ca2+. A significant effect of ionic strengths on the sorption has been observed. Clay minerals with 2 : 1 structure (bentonite, illite) showed much higher sorption than that of 1 : 1 structure (kaolinite). Zeolite showed high selectivity for C-137 sorption. Sorption behavior of Cs-137 clay minerals can be explained by their surface charge characteristics originated from mineral structure.
